Service Brakes, Hydraulic
03/15/2023
The contact owns a 2015 Volvo S60. The contact stated while driving 20 MPH, the brake pedal was depressed however, the vehicle failed to stop until the brake pedal had gone to the floorboard. There was no warning light illuminated. The vehicle was taken to the dealer, but no failure was found. The contact stated that the failure had occurred several times. The contact stated that the vehicle was test driven by the mechanic however, the cause of the failure was not yet determined.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ure and no assistance was offered. The failure mileage was approximately 14,000.

Engine And Engine Cooling, engine
05/11/2022
The contact owns a 2015 Volvo S60. The contact stated that the vehicle was previously repaired under an unknown recall for the catalytic converter and the check engine warning light illuminated. The contact was told that the catalytic converter had failed due to an oil leak. The contact was informed that the catalytic converter needed to be replaced.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ure and informed the contact that the vehicle had exceeded the mileage. There was no additional assistance provided. The approximate failure mileage was 165,000. The dealer stated the vehicle is outside of the warranty perimeters by mileage.

Vehicle Speed Control, service Brakes
04/06/2023
The contact owns a 2015 Volvo S60. The contact stated while driving approximately 15 MPH and slowing down for a crosswalk with pedestrians in the crosswalk, the vehicle independently accelerated while depressing the brake pedal. The contact stated that she had not noticed any warning lights being illuminated. The contact stated that the failure was intermittent. The contact had taken the vehicle to a local dealer, where it was diagnosed and determined that the failure could not be duplicated. The vehicle had not been repaired. The manufacturer had been informed of the failure. The failure mileage was approximately 15,000.

Engine
03/27/2023
I have a 2015 Volvo S60 T5 that I purchased 08 -2021 from Volvo that is consuming oil. I have had the oil changed (out of pocket) 3 times within 10,000 miles because the low oil light was on and I had purchased a extended warranty and wanted to play it safe. Never once did any Volvo service staff mention that this model car had a issue with oil consumption. After researching this cars history I came across a bulletin on the NHTSA webpage that Volvo has known about the issue on or around 11-02-2020. Webpage ( https://static.nhtsa.gov/odi/tsbs/2020/MC-10184147-9999.pdf) I received a letter from Volvo about Excessive oil consumption dated February 3, 2023 and I contacted their customer service department. I was told that my car original delivery date was Sept 2014 and that the car is now out of warranty and I would have to pay for anything related to the oil consumption issue.
